M-PVA Ak1x NHS-activated beads

Standard particle sizes:

M-PVA Ak11: 0.5 - 1 µm (article No. 221)

M-PVA Ak12: 1 - 3 µm (article No. 222)

Min. quantity delivered:

2 ml bead suspension

Concentration: Magnetite:

50 - 60 %

Activation degree:

M-PVA Ak11 390 µmol NHS/g
M-PVA Ak12 350 µmol NHS/g

Binding capacity:

M-PVA Ak11 8 - 20 mg protein/g
M-PVA Ak12 5 - 15 mg protein/g

Storage:

in isopropanol

Stability:

at least 1 month at 4 °C

Properties: These superparamagnetic beads consist of a matrix of carboxylated polyvinyl alcohol, which is subsequently activated with N-hydroxysuccinimidyl (NHS) ester functionalities and can therefore be used for the direct coupling of proteins, nucleic acids or other ligands with amino functionalities.

M-PVA Ak2x NCO-activated beads

Standard particle sizes:

M-PVA Ak21: 0.5 - 1 µm (article No. 224)

M-PVA Ak22: 1 - 3 µm (article No. 225)

Min. quantity delivered:

2 ml bead suspension

Concentration:

25 mg/ml

Magnetite:

50 - 60 %

Activation degree:

M-PVA Ak21 250 µmol NCO/g
M-PVA Ak22 220 µmol NCO/g

Storage:

in dimethylformamide (DMF)

Stability:

at least 1 month at 4 °C

Properties: These superparamagnetic beads consist of a matrix of polyvinyl alcohol, which is subsequently activated by the introduction of isocyanate funcionalities via an eightatom spacer. M-PVA Ak2x can therefore be used for the direct coupling of molecules containing amino or hydroxy functionalities.
